How much do remote vet tech instructor j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 2, 2026, the average yearly pay for remote vet tech instructor in Florida is $53,607.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$45,200.00 and $56,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a typical day look like for a Remote Vet Tech Instructor and how do they interact with students?

A typical day for a Remote Vet Tech Instructor involves preparing and delivering online lectures, managing interactive class discussions, grading assignments, and providing timely feedback to students. You may also hold virtual office hours, develop engaging course materials, and collaborate with other faculty members to continually improve the curriculum. Most interactions with students occur through learning management platforms, video calls, and email, allowing for both synchronous and asynchronous communication. Instructors play a crucial role in supporting student learning, guiding practical skill development, and fostering a sense of community in the virtual classroom. This structure allows for a flexible but highly engaging teaching environment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Remote Vet Tech Instructor position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Vet Tech Instructor, you need a degree or certification in veterinary technology, hands-on clinical experience, and a background in teaching or curriculum development. Familiarity with online learning platforms, video conferencing tools, learning management systems (LMS), and relevant veterinary certifications such as CVT, LVT, or RVT are typically required. Excellent communication, patience, mentorship abilities, and the capacity to engage students virtually are important soft skills for this role. These competencies ensure effective instruction, foster student success, and maintain high educational standards in a remote learning environment.

What is a Remote Vet Tech Instructor job?

A Remote Vet Tech Instructor is a professional who teaches veterinary technology courses online. They develop lesson plans, deliver lectures, assess student performance, and provide academic support in a virtual environment. This role requires a background in veterinary technology, teaching experience, and proficiency with online learning platforms. Remote instructors must ensure students gain the necessary knowledge and skills to succeed in the veterinary field. They may also collaborate with other faculty and stay updated on industry standards.

Technical Instructor

SOSi

Doral, FL • Remote

Full-time

Re-posted 21 days ago


Job description

Company Description

Founded in 1989, SOSi is among the largest private, founder-owned technology and services integrators in the defense and government services industry. We deliver tailored solutions, tested leadership, and trusted results to enable national security missions worldwide.

Job Description

**This position is contingent upon contract award**

SOSi is seeking a Technical Instructor to support mission requirements for a structured approach to further develop, integrate, and sustain a scalable, federated data ecosystem that enhances interoperability, governance, and mission-driven analytics for a DoD customer. The primary objective of the program is to bridge the operational gaps between DoD, IC, interagency, and non-traditional international partners to enable real-time information sharing, dynamic data integration, and mission-tailored analytical capabilities.

Essential Job Duties:

  • Responsible for developing and delivering advanced instruction to an expanded title authority program training audience such as title 10/50 Military Intelligence Program (MIP) and in areas such as:
    • ESRI Software and Geospatial Data Analysis
    • API-based data integration and request workflows
    • Jupyter Notebook-based data engineering and geospatial data layer creation
    • Metadata tagging, data stewardship, and catalog integration
    • OSINT analysis techniques and structured reporting workflows
  • Coordinates closely with the Training Coordinator to align technical content with approved training events and mission objectives.
  • Develop and maintain a training data tracking and reporting capability, under the direction of the Government, to support program performance visibility and strategic planning.
  • Provide dashboard inputs summarizing this data for Government approval on a bi-weekly basis (aligned with sprint reporting) and shall update the dashboard within 5 business days following the conclusion of each training event.
  • Document the planning, delivery, and evaluation of each training program purchased, including travel coordination, curriculum verification, and on-site logistics. A post-execution summary report shall be submitted within 10 business days of event completion.
  • Coordinate country clearances, travel arrangements, and liaison activities with sponsoring Commands, U.S. embassies, and partner nation representatives.
  • Facilitate graduation ceremonies, ensuring proper documentation of participant completion and skill mastery.
  • Implement post-training assessments and evaluations, gathering participant feedback and performance metrics to refine future training iterations.
  • Provide a comprehensive training impact report, detailing the effectiveness of knowledge transfer, skill adoption rates, and recommendations for program enhancement.
  • Administer post-training language satisfaction surveys to partner nation trainees, collecting quantitative and qualitative feedback on language accessibility, translation accuracy, and instructor communication.
  • Compile and analyze feedback data quarterly, identifying trends, deficiencies, and areas for improvement in multilingual training delivery.
  • Provide an annual report summarizing language feedback insights, corrective actions taken, and recommendations for improving multilingual training effectiveness.
  • Host remote training materials, provide access to self-paced learning modules, and facilitate sessions.
  • Track participant engagement in remote training materials.
  • Provide a quarterly report on remote training participation, knowledge retention rates, and areas requiring further improvement.
Qualifications

Minimum Requirements

  • Active TS/SCI Clearance.
  • Bachelor's degree in Education, Instructional Design, Intelligence Studies, Data Science, or a related field, or;
    • a minimum of five (5) years of equivalent experience in technical training, curriculum development, or applied instruction.
  • Expert-level knowledge in data engineering, geospatial analysis, and open-source intelligence (OSINT) methodologies.
  • Demonstrated proficiency in developing and delivering training on the use of Jupyter Notebooks, API integrations, metadata management, and structured data layer development.
  • Familiarity with secure data environments, role-based access controls (RBAC), and cataloging standards is essential.
  • Skilled in creating and adapting hands-on instructional content for technical users, including practical exercises that simulate real-world data processing, analysis, and visualization tasks.
  • Ability to coordinate with the Training Coordinator to align delivery with broader training objectives and ensure content is responsive to Government-directed priorities.
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ills are required to facilitate documentation, post-training support, and dynamic engagement with both U.S. and partner nation personnel.
  • Demonstrate working knowledge of OSINT methodologies, geospatial data analysis, or intelligence tradecraft, with practical exposure to ESRI ArcGIS, dashboard analytics, Jupyter Notebooks, or other mission-relevant tools.

Preferred Qualifications

  • Experience supporting interagency collaboration, training program evaluation, or working with international or partner-nation personnel is desirable but not required for baseline qualification.
  • The position is suited for junior to mid-level professionals with strong instructional delivery skills and the ability to develop practical, scenario-based technical content.
